Transaction 427f86a60bccf24454206b68377cf91ef1dd5c2bf36b74f578ff6bf376e8f149

1 Input
2 Outputs
  • 427f86a60bccf24454206b68377cf91ef1dd5c2bf36b74f578ff6bf376e8f149:0
  • value  3854500
    address  13Ghh85d6HpF5zjw3RwuNFppTbgj1gTS66
  • 427f86a60bccf24454206b68377cf91ef1dd5c2bf36b74f578ff6bf376e8f149:1
  • value  1264231094
    address  1LE6pU5bpDuBYmAshTqYm8MNcKZnrcH8Rm